Agglutination method for the determination of multiple ligands
First Claim
1. A method for determining the presence or absence of each of a predetermined number of different ligands selected from one or two ligands in a liquid, semi-liquid or pasty specimen, by a direct or indirect agglutination, or an agglutination inhibition method by competition, comprising the steps:
- contacting the specimen with a predetermined number of homogeneous populations of fluorescent beads, each population having a specific fluorescence and having one or more predetermined antiligands fixed to their surface, said predetermined number of populations being equal to said predetermined number of ligands;
analyzing said specimen containing said beads using a measuring means capable of discriminating between the specific fluorescence of said beads for each ligand, said measuring means being selected from the group consisting of a flow cytometer, an image analyzer and a laser sweep system;
determining in response to said analyzing step the number of non-agglutinated beads, the number of agglutinated beads, the number of bead aggregates and for each aggregate, the number of the beads it comprises, by absolute measurement of the intensity and the fluorescence wavelength of each particle or aggregate of particles, one by one; and
correlating the information determined in said determining step with the presence or absence in said specimen, of each of said different ligands to thereby enable the simultaneous determination of a plurality of ligands using a single bead contacting step.

Abstract
The invention provides a method capable of determining the presence or absence of each of a plurality of different ligands in a specimen. The specimen is contacted with a predetermined number of different homogeneous populations of fluorescence beads having one or more predetermined antiligands affixed to their surface. The specimen and bead mixture is analyzed using a means having a single parameter for measuring the fluorescence per ligand to determine the number of nonagglutinated beads, the number of agglutinated beads, the number of bead aggregates, and for each aggregate, the number of beads it comprises. This information is used to correlate the presence or absence in the specimen of each of the different ligands analyzed for. The method of the invention thus provides for the simultaneous determination of a predetermined number of ligands in a specimen using only a single bead contacting step.
